Unveiling Broadleaf Plantain: A Closer Look
🍃 Broadleaf Plantain stands out with its wide, sturdy leaves, a hallmark of the Plantago genus that sets it apart from its cousin, Ribwort Plantain. Thriving in diverse environments, this herb is packed with flavonoids, iridoids, mucilage, tannins, and essential minerals—each contributing to its healing prowess. Whether you spot it in your backyard or a local field, this unassuming plant holds a treasure trove of health-enhancing properties waiting to be harnessed. Its versatility makes it a standout choice for anyone seeking natural wellness solutions.

Recipes to Inspire Your Wellness Journey
🌿 Broadleaf Plantain Smoothie
Blend 1 handful of washed plantain leaves, 1 banana, 1 cubed apple, 1/2 cup Greek yogurt, 1/2 cup almond milk, and 1 tablespoon honey. Add ice if desired. Enjoy a refreshing boost of vitality.
Broadleaf Plantain Tea
Boil 2 cups of water, add 1-2 tablespoons of dried or fresh leaves, and steep for 10-15 minutes. Strain and serve warm, with honey or lemon to taste.
Broadleaf Plantain Pesto
Process 2 cups of washed plantain leaves, 2 garlic cloves, and 1/4 cup cashews (toasted, optional). Slowly add 1/4 cup olive oil, then mix in lemon juice, salt, and pepper. Use as a versatile spread or dip.

Safety and Balance: Using Broadleaf Plantain Wisely
⚠️ While Broadleaf Plantain is generally safe, moderation is essential. Start with small amounts—1-2 teaspoons of dried leaves or a few fresh ones—to gauge your body’s response. Overuse may cause mild digestive discomfort, so listen to your system. If you’re pregnant, nursing, or on medication, consult a healthcare provider to ensure it fits your needs.
